Customs Act 1901

 

Notice under Paragraph 15(2)(b)

 

Boarding Station Revocation and Appointment (No. 22/14) –

Gold Coast Airport

 

I, Vincci Choy, delegate of the Comptroller-General of Customs, under paragraph 15(2)(b) of the Customs Act 1901:

 

(a)  Revoke the notice titled ‘CUSTOMS ACT 1901 NOTICE UNDER SECTION 15 APPOINTMENT NOTICE’, published in the Gazette No.42 on 20 October 2004, appointing the boarding station at Gold Coast Airport in the State of Queensland; and

(b)  Appoint the areas at Gold Coast Airport in the State of Queensland within the red boundary lines as indicated in Attachment A to this notice to be boarding stations.

 

Dated the 26th day of October 2022.

 

 

(Signed)

 

 

Vincci Choy

Director Ports Policy

Traveller Policy and Industry Engagement Branch

Industry and Border Systems Group

Australian Border Force
